Walking tours & neighbourhoods Experience the charm of Osh through a private walking tour, exploring its diverse neighbourhoods with a local guide. This ancient city offers a glimpse into Kyrgyzstan's rich tapestry of culture and traditions. - Sulaiman-Too Mountain: A spiritual and historical site that draws cultural tourists. You can explore its caves and museums, gaining insight into the region's religious significance and breathtaking city views. - Jayma Bazaar: Perfect for families and those keen on authentic experiences. This lively market is one of the oldest in Central Asia, offering a vast array of local goods, fresh produce, and traditional crafts. - Osh City Park: A peaceful retreat for multi-generational groups, this park offers lush greenery and plenty of space for picnics or leisurely walks while enjoying the mountain backdrop. Day trip ideas from Osh From Osh, nearby valleys, historic towns and waterfalls sit within reach, so day trips let you trade busy bazaars for open views without long logistics. - Uzgen: The Karakhanid minaret and brick mausoleums anchor a compact historic complex, rice fields stretch toward the river and cafés serve rich plov, and your tour can pair site time with a walk through the market streets for everyday snapshots. - Alay Valley: Wide grasslands and big-sky vistas lead toward the snow of Peak Lenin, with roadside viewpoints and quiet villages breaking up the drive, and a full-day tour works best when you plan a few photo stops on the passes and a simple lunch in Sary-Tash. - Arslanbob: A vast walnut forest, cool waterfalls and a friendly mountain village make an easy nature escape, and your tour can be a gentle forest walk to the Small Waterfall or a longer hike to ridge views before tea in a local courtyard. - Abshir-Ata Waterfall: A limestone gorge frames a blue pool that locals visit for its fresh spray and scenery, picnic spots sit along the river and short paths climb to viewpoints, so your tour stays flexible if you want more time by the water. - Kyrgyz-Ata National Park: Red rock walls, juniper slopes and a clear river create simple hiking and photo stops close to the city, and your tour can linger on riverbank paths or explore a side valley for quiet panoramas.
